Job description

Catering Assistant

17.5 hours per week, Part Time

Permanent

Term Time Only, 43.6 weeks per year

At St Barnabas we strive to help every child to, ‘achieve great things’ and live ‘life in all its fullness’ by inspiring them with rich, fun experiences and equipping them with a love of learning. Our school has a strong Christian ethos built on our core Gospel values which the children chose themselves: Trust, Forgiveness,Friendship, Generosity, Respect, Service and Courage. St Barnabas was known in the Bible as an encourager so we try to follow his example and encourage others. With close links with our parish church, other schools in our multi-academy Trust and our dedicated team of staff, governors and parents, we take pride in, “Learning and growing together in a love-filled Christian family”.

We are looking for a Catering Assistant to join our school catering team and support the smooth running of the kitchen and lunchtime service. The successful candidate will work alongside our existing team to help prepare and serve meals, ensuring a welcoming lunchtime experience for our pupils and staff.

The right candidate will have:
  • Experience working in a customer-focused environment, ideally in catering
  • Experience supporting basic food preparation and following health and safety procedures
  • Level 2 Food Hygiene Certificate (or the ability to take within 6 months)
  • Ability to work under pressure and use own initiative
  • A high level of communication and organisational skills
  • The ability to use relevant technology and catering systems
  • A can-do attitude and strong customer service ethos
  • A commitment to the health, wellbeing and positive experience of pupils through the catering provision
